Description
TQ 05NW BOROUGH OF WOKING HIGH STREET, OLD WOKING
6/68 The Grange 14/4/76 II
House. c1800. Colourwashed stucco to front, rendered sides; hipped slate roof with rendered stacks at left end and right of centre. 2 storeys, rusticated on rendered plinth; symmetrical 7 bay facade, centre 3 bays recessed. Glazing bar sash windows with wooden bracket and panels above on first floor, channelled voussoirs over ground floor windows. Central 6 panel door under flat porch hood on multiple columns of quatrofoil section with string moulding at one-thirds and two-thirds height.
